Olympia Industries Bhd (3018) — Net Asset Quality Index
Olympia Industries Bhd (3018)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 54.2% as of June 2026.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of RM549.78 Million minus total liabilities of RM251.57 Million yields net assets of RM298.21 Million. Annual Net Asset Quality Index for Olympia Industries Bhd (2012–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Net Asset Quality Index for Olympia Industries Bhd from 2012 to 2025, covering 14 annual filings. Each row shows total assets, total liabilities, net assets, the quality index percentage,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| Quality Index | Net Assets (MYR) | Total Assets | Total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 55.6% | RM303.78 Million | RM546.82 Million | RM243.04 Million | ▼ -2.0 pp |
| 2024 | 57.6% | RM321.96 Million | RM559.28 Million | RM237.32 Million | ▼ -3.4 pp |
| 2023 | 61.0% | RM335.54 Million | RM549.97 Million | RM214.43 Million | ▼ -2.3 pp |
| 2022 | 63.3% | RM351.32 Million | RM554.90 Million | RM203.58 Million | ▲ +1.0 pp |
| 2021 | 62.3% | RM364.53 Million | RM584.85 Million | RM220.32 Million | ▼ -0.1 pp |
| 2020 | 62.4% | RM375.71 Million | RM601.92 Million | RM226.21 Million | ▼ -1.1 pp |
| 2019 | 63.5% | RM404.15 Million | RM636.61 Million | RM232.46 Million | ▼ -2.4 pp |
| 2018 | 65.9% | RM426.92 Million | RM647.58 Million | RM220.67 Million | ▲ +10.2 pp |
| 2017 | 55.7% | RM417.26 Million | RM748.50 Million | RM331.24 Million | ▲ +5.8 pp |
| 2016 | 49.9% | RM383.96 Million | RM768.94 Million | RM384.97 Million | ▼ -1.3 pp |
| 2015 | 51.3% | RM386.00 Million | RM753.00 Million | RM367.00 Million | ▲ +0.1 pp |
| 2014 | 51.2% | RM390.00 Million | RM762.00 Million | RM372.00 Million | ▼ -3.1 pp |
| 2013 | 54.3% | RM373.00 Million | RM687.00 Million | RM314.00 Million | ▲ +3.8 pp |
| 2012 | 50.5% | RM368.00 Million | RM729.00 Million | RM361.00 Million | — |
